Job Purpose and Impact
- The Sr. Consultant, Cyber Engineering & Technology Operations job designs, implements and operates the cybersecurity protective technologies, with a primary focus on cloud security technology, within the organization. With minimal supervision, this job oversees and ensures robust protection against threats while supporting operational efficiency.
Key Accountabilities
- CYBERSECURITY TECHNOLOGIES: Designs, implements and operates endpoint cybersecurity protective technologies, including endpoint detection and response, cloud infrastructure controls and network protections.
- TECHNOLOGY MANAGEMENT: Leads technologies such as wide area network, partner gateways, internet of things security, email, collaboration tools, local area network, wireless and network segmentation, virtual private networks, proxies, demilitarized zones, middle tier systems, databases, and web servers.
- CO-CREATION WITH IT OPERATIONS: Partners with internal cross functional teams to co-create shared infrastructure initiatives.
- IT SERVICE MANAGEMENT INTERFACES: Operates and reviews all information technology service management interfaces, including asset, change, configuration, problem, and request management.
- RESEARCHES SECURITY NEEDS: Researches complex system security needs for operations development, including security requirements definition, risk assessment and systems analysis.
- SECURITY POLICIES: Performs complex analysis and partners to establish security policy in compliance with industry standards.
- INCIDENT RESPONSE: Prepares and performs complex incident response, disaster recovery and business continuity planning, ensuring readiness for potential security breaches.
Qualifications
- Minimum requirement of 4 years of relevant work experience. Typically reflects 5 years or more of relevant experience.
- Hands on experience with Microsoft Azure ecosystem, AWS, Google Cloud Platform, and cloud security posture management
